How to Convert Second to Radian
1 second = 4.84814 × 10-6 radians
Radian = Second × 4.84814 × 10-6
Example: 10014" × 4.84814 × 10-6 = 0.048549 rad

About these units
Second: An arcsecond (second of arc) is 1/60 of an arcminute.It is common in astronomy, surveying, astrometry, and precision optics for high-precision angles.
